Bigg Boss 19 premiered with a splash, introducing sixteen new celebrity contestants to the audience. The contestants this season represent a diverse range of talent, from television and music to social media. In a notable moment, Mridul Tiwari won a spot in the house after a face-off against Shehbaz Badesha. Despite the initial outcome, there is strong speculation that Shehbaz Badesha, the brother of Shehnaaz Gill and a Punjabi singer, has been placed in the secret room. This mirrors past seasons where contestants were temporarily hidden. Rumors indicate he may enter the main house within a week. Shehbaz has since taken to Instagram to thank his fans for their support. Furthermore, there are discussions about wild card entries, with Shehbaz Badesha and actress Khushi Dubey potentially joining the competition later on. The season’s theme, ‘Gharwalon Ki Sarkaar,’ which takes inspiration from democracy, has been teased in a promotional video starring Salman Khan. The other contestants include Neelam, Gaurav Khanna, Amaal Mallik, Ashnoor Kaur, Awez Darbar, Nagma Mirajkar, Zeishan Qadri, Baseer Ali, Abhishek Bajaj, Tanya Mittal, Kunickaa Sadanand, Nataila Janoszek, Pranit More, Nehal Chudasama, Mridul Tiwari, and Farhana Bhatt.
